Hi! My name is Kannetha, I am a Cambodian American photo student at MassArt looking to fund my project in my community of Asian Americans in Rhode Island. I need funding for film, equipment, darkroom supplies, travel, and exhibition funds. I plan on turning this project into a book and working on it for at least 2 years. This project is being shot in black and white, with an 8x10 large format film camera. This camera has an extensive history of BIPOC exploitation, especially with Asian immigration photographs. For my own Khmer community, the Khmer Rouge used black and white film and darkroom printing to make photos of their genocide victims. I must reclaim these experiences. It is also a major privilege and a fantastic opportunity to be using this camera. This is a super expensive medium; 1 box of 25 sheets of film costs $179, and 1 box of 100 sheets of darkroom paper costs $150, in addition to saving up to buy frames, printing paper, and the camera itself after I graduate.
